Comprehending Electric Treadmills
Electric treadmills are motorized workout machines that allow users to stroll, jog, or work on a moving belt. They come equipped with different functions designed to boost the workout experience, making them a popular choice for home fitness centers and business gym. Below are some necessary elements and features typically found in electric treadmills:
FeatureDescriptionMotor PowerDetermined in horse power, affecting speed and efficiency. Usually ranges from 1.5 to 4.0 HP.Running Surface AreaThe size of the running belt, impacting comfort and use. Standard sizes vary in between 18-22 inches in width and 48-60 inches in length.Slope OptionsCapability to change the treadmill's slope, improving exercise strength. Ranges typically from 0% to 15% or more.Integrated ProgramsPre-set exercise programs created to assist users through different workout regimens.Heart Rate MonitorIntegrated sensors or chest straps to track heart rate throughout exercises.Folding MechanismFeature that enables simple storage of the treadmill, saving area when not in usage.Advantages of Electric Treadmills

Secret Considerations When Purchasing an Electric Treadmill
Before buying an electric treadmill, potential purchasers should think about several elements that could impact their choice:
Price Range: Treadmills differ widely in rate based upon their features and quality, from budget options around ₤ 300 to high-end models surpassing ₤ 2000.
Motor Power: A motor with a minimum of 2.0 HP is suggested for routine runners, while walkers might discover lower horse power sufficient.
Running Surface Size: Those with longer strides or wanting to run at high speeds should choose a larger running surface for included convenience and safety.
Slope and Decline Features: If increasing exercise strength is an objective, consider models that use incline and decline capabilities.
Warranty and Customer Support: Look for brand names with solid warranties, which show confidence in their product's sturdiness and dependability.
Upkeep Tips for Electric Treadmills
To make sure durability and optimum performance of an electric treadmill, routine maintenance is necessary. Here are suggestions on how to take care of your treadmill:
Keep it Clean: Dust and particles can build up in the machine. Clean it down routinely to remove dirt.
Lubricate the Belt: Follow the manufacturer's guidelines concerning lubrication, usually required every six months, to prevent wear and tear on the belt.
Look for Wear: Periodically examine the running belt for signs of wear and tear. Change it as essential.
Examine Cables and Connections: Ensure that all electrical connections and cable televisions are intact to preserve safety and functionality.
Screen Performance: Be observant of unusual sounds, and if performance decreases, describe the treadmill's handbook for troubleshooting or consult professionals.
Frequently Asked Questions About Electric Treadmills
1. How much space do I need for a treadmill?
Space requirements vary by model. Typically, a minimum location of 6 feet by 3 feet is encouraged for safe operation, but ensure extra space for incline changes.
2. Are electric treadmills suitable for everybody?
Yes, however it's suggested for people with pre-existing health conditions to speak with a health care professional before beginning a new exercise program.
3. What type of maintenance do electric treadmills need?
Routine maintenance includes cleansing, lubrication, and evaluation of elements, along with regular look for any wear and tear.
